Scattered snow, then sunny Sunday

Mostly cloudy skies dominate through the rest of Saturday evening. Possible scattered snow showers early evening, before tapering off overnight. Temperatures will fall out of the 20s Saturday evening and bottom out in the mid teens overnight.

Decreasing clouds early morning will give way to partly sunny skies Sunday. Chilly Sunday in the mid to upper 20’s.

Presidents Day Monday, under a strong southerly flow, temperatures will rise to unseasonable highs near 50 degrees. Staying dry throughout Monday, but clouds arrive ahead of a cold front. Becoming breezy with rain arriving Monday evening. Possible heavy rain overnight at times.

Tuesday, rain changing to snow early then tapering off. Breezy at times with winds between 15-20mph. Gusts near 30mph. Temperatures falling from the 30s into the 20s Tuesday evening.

Wednesday will be dry with a mix of sun and clouds, but still chilly in the upper 20s.

Cloudy and breezy through the day Thursday with rain or snow arriving Thursday afternoon. Highs in the lower 30s.
